Note that you may not be able to scroll when a plugin has focus. You would have to use the scroll bar to scroll or make sure that the plugin area doesn't ave focus.

On Mac the scroll bars can be hidden and only have them show when you scroll the page so you can see the current scroll position. The idea is that a touch pad is used that doesn't require the scroll bars to be visible and thus have more screen estate for the browsing area. You can make the scroll bars always visible: System Preferences > General > Show Scroll Bar > Choose "Always"
